Four-star forward Carson Crawford picks Arizona State
Carson Crawford, a four-star small forward from Fleming Island, Florida, has committed to Arizona State. The 6-foot-6 senior is ranked No. 47 overall in the 2027 class and No. 12 among small forwards by the Rivals Industry Ranking.
Crawford's pledge gives Arizona State a notable boost on the recruiting trail, adding a versatile wing with significant size for the position. His top-50 national standing places him among the more coveted prospects in his class, and the Sun Devils' ability to pull him out of Florida highlights their expanding recruiting reach beyond the West Coast.
